Hamilton Heights, St. Louis, MO Guía Local

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Hamilton Heights?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Hamilton Heights | $1,259 | $649 | $3,000 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Hamilton Heights | $1,652 | $550 | $4,000 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Hamilton Heights | $2,146 | $669 | $5,442 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Hamilton Heights | $2,035 | $687 | $6,895 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Hamilton Heights | $1,533 | $893 | $2,350 |
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ar una casa en Hamilton Heights?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as con 2 Dormitorios | $1,462 | $725 | $3,395 |
| Casas con 3 Dormitorios | $1,974 | $1,050 | $3,725 |
| Casas con 4 Dormitorios | $1,697 | $1,400 | $1,995 |
| Casas con 5 Dormitorios | $1,000 | $1,000 | $1,000 |
| Casas con 6 Dormitorios | $3,700 | $3,700 | $3,700 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re Hamilton Heights
¿Cuál es el precio y la disponibilidad actual de los apartamentos en alquiler en el área de Hamilton Heights en St. Louis, MO?
A día de hoy, 04 de Agosto, 2026, hay 586 apartamentos disponibles en Hamilton Heights con precios desde $550 hasta $6,895 y un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,779.
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Hamilton Heights?
Actualmente hay 126 Apartamentos Estudios en Hamilton Heights con alquileres que van desde $649 hasta $3,000, con un precio medio de $1,259.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Hamilton Heights?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Hamilton Heights varian entre $550 y $4,000 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,652
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Hamilton Heights?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Hamilton Heights van desde $669 hasta $5,442.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,146
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Hamilton Heights?
En estos momentos hay 100 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Hamilton Heights en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$687 y $6,895 - con una media de $2,035 para el lugar.
